在快速发展的前端开发领域,框架的选择对于提高开发效率和项目质量至关重要。垂直框架,作为一种专注于特定领域或功能的框架,能够帮助开发者突破传统框架的局限,实现更高效的开发。本文将深入探讨高效前端垂直框架的秘密,分析其设计理念、优势以及在实际应用中的表现。
一、什么是前端垂直框架?
前端垂直框架是指在特定领域或功能上具有针对性的框架。与通用框架相比,垂直框架专注于解决特定问题,提供更为精细化的解决方案。例如,一些垂直框架专注于前端性能优化、UI组件库、状态管理等。
二、垂直框架的设计理念
- 专注性:垂直框架专注于解决特定领域的问题,通过提供针对性的工具和组件,帮助开发者快速实现功能。
- 模块化:垂直框架采用模块化设计,将功能划分为独立的模块,便于开发者按需引入和使用。
- 易用性:垂直框架注重用户体验,提供简洁、易用的接口和文档,降低开发门槛。
三、垂直框架的优势
- 提高开发效率:垂直框架提供了一系列工具和组件,开发者可以快速搭建项目,节省开发时间。
- 提升项目质量:垂直框架通过规范化的编码和设计,提高代码质量,降低维护成本。
- 降低学习成本:垂直框架简化了开发流程,开发者无需深入了解底层技术,即可快速上手。
四、高效前端垂直框架案例分析
- Vue.js:Vue.js 是一款流行的前端框架,其核心库只关注视图层,易于上手。Vue.js 提供了组件化、响应式和虚拟DOM等特性,极大地提高了开发效率。
- React:React 是一个用于构建用户界面的JavaScript库。React 通过虚拟DOM和组件化思想,实现了高效的页面更新和复用。
- Angular:Angular 是一个由Google维护的前端框架。Angular 2及以后版本采用了TypeScript作为开发语言,提供了双向数据绑定、组件化等特性,极大地提高了开发效率。
五、总结
高效前端垂直框架通过专注、模块化和易用性等特点,为开发者提供了便捷的开发体验。在实际应用中,选择合适的垂直框架可以帮助开发者突破传统框架的局限,提高开发效率和项目质量。然而,开发者在使用垂直框架时,应结合项目需求和团队技能,选择最合适的框架,以实现最佳的开发效果。